BioSpace Launches 2022 Hotbed Maps to Highlight Thriving Life Sciences Clusters

BioSpace, Inc., the leading life sciences news and careers site, has unveiled their 2022 Hotbed Maps, celebrating thriving life sciences organizations across the United States.

BioSpace Hotbed Maps feature nine of the most important regions in the life sciences industry. Original watercolor maps provide an at-a-glance reference to the industry’s leading innovators, employers and investors and have been a favorite of the life sciences community since they were first launched in 1989.

As the life sciences industry has grown and diversified across the U.S., new Hotbeds have emerged in recent years, including Lone Star Bio (Texas), BioForest (Washington, Oregon) and BioNC (Research Triangle Park, North Carolina). Additionally, BioSpace features the most promising start-ups in its NextGen Bio map.

Hotbed Map Regions

Biotech Bay (San Francisco Bay and Northern California), Biotech Beach (San Diego and Southern California), Genetown (Boston, Cambridge), Pharm Country (Connecticut, New York, New Jersey,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island), BioMidwest (comprising 9 states), BioCapital (D.C., Delaware, Maryland, Virginia), Lone Star Bio (Texas), Bio NC (Research Triangle Park, North Carolina), BioForest (Washington, Oregon), NextGen Bio.
